Which should you buy?

First Camera / Beginner Photography — EOS R100 (2023): The R100 does the basics well at the lowest possible price point. Its main value is as a gateway into the Canon RF ecosystem — the lenses you buy now will work on any Canon body you upgrade to later. Modest ambitions, reliably met.

Fine Art, Portrait & Entry-Level Medium Format — Hasselblad X1D II 50C (2019): The most accessible Hasselblad XCD body — 50MP medium-format quality for those who cannot stretch to the X2D 100C.

Lifestyle, Street & Casual Shooters — Nikon Zfc (2021): Nikon's most beautiful camera — FM2-inspired dials and styling wrapped around a capable modern sensor with Z-mount access.

Full specifications

Specification EOS R100 (2023)Hasselblad X1D II 50C (2019)Nikon Zfc (2021)
Price £529 £3,999 £799
Sensor 24.1MP APS-C CMOS 50MP medium-format CMOS (43.8 × 32.9mm) 20.9MP APS-C CMOS
Resolution 24.1MP 50.0MP 20.9MP
Video 4K/30p (slight crop), 1080p/60p None 4K/30p (slight crop), 1080p/120p
Autofocus Dual Pixel CMOS AF, face detection, subject tracking Contrast-detect AF Hybrid phase/contrast AF with subject detection
Stabilisation None (no IBIS) None None (lens-based only)
Burst Rate 6.5fps mechanical 2.7fps 11fps
Battery Life ~270 shots (CIPA) 370 shots (CIPA) 300 shots (CIPA)
Weight 356g (body, battery, card) 766g body only 445g body only
Dimensions 116.3 × 85.5 × 68.8mm 148.0 × 97.0 × 73.8mm 134.5 × 93.5 × 43.5mm
Weather Sealed No No No
Viewfinder EVF, 2.36M dots, 0.59× magnification 0.87" OLED EVF, 3.69M dots 0.39" OLED EVF, 2.36M dots
Screen 3.0" fixed touchscreen, 1.04M dots 3.6" touchscreen 3.0" fully articulating touchscreen
Mount Canon RF-mount Hasselblad XCD Nikon Z-mount
Memory Cards Single SD UHS-II Dual SD UHS-II Single UHS-I SD
Connectivity USB-C, Wi-Fi, Bluetooth USB-C, Wi-Fi, Bluetooth USB-C, Wi-Fi, Bluetooth
